Why it matters

Supapool targets a real setup bottleneck, but database creation and migrations are external-system changes that need preview, backup, and rollback discipline.

Who should use it

Developers prototyping backends who can review generated schema and migration plans.

Who should skip it

Pass on Supapool if your environment cannot support the access controls and sandboxing this risk profile requires.

How this item is evaluated

RepoRadar assigned Supapool a composite score of 7.9 out of 10, placing it in the Bronze tier. This score combines weighted sub-signals: usefulness (35%), novelty (18%), momentum (14%), maturity (10%), open-source/build quality (7%), evidence quality (6%), workflow potential (6%), and setup ease (4%). Popularity is tracked separately at 0.0 and never affects the composite score or tier. The risk label of 'high' reflects inherent user-impacting hazards, not generic novelty.
